F. J. Villanueva received the Computer Eng. Diploma from the University of Castilla-La Mancha (UCLM) in 2001. In 2009 he obtained the PhD degree from the UCLM, where he is now working as Teaching Assistant. His research interests include wireless sensor networks, ambient intelligence and embedded systems.

It can no longer be ignored that Ambient Intelligence concepts are moving away from research labs demonstrators into our daily lives in a slow but continuous manner. However, we are still far from concluding that our living spaces are intelligent and are enhancing our living style. Ambient Intelligence has attracted much attention from multidisciplinary research areas and there are still open issues in most of them. In this book a selection of unsolved problems which are considered key for ambient intelligence to become a reality, is analyzed and studied in depth. Hopefully this book will provide the reader with a good idea about the current research lines in ambient intelligence, a good overview of existing works and identify potential solutions for each one of these problems.
